會讓程序員爭論起來的幾個話題
素材來源:網(wǎng)絡(luò)
1、世界上最好的編程語言
這個話題是千年老梗,但只要論壇有小白提問總會引起爭論。
A:Python 是最好的編程語言
B:Java 是最好的編程語言
C:PHP 是最好的編程語言
D:C 才是最好的編程語言
2、HTML 是不是編程語言
應(yīng)該不算吧。
3、前端是不是程序員
如果不是程序員,是不是要叫美工或切圖仔。
4、if 后面的大括號要不要換行
這個問題類似豆?jié){是要吃甜還是咸的,因人而異。
但是如果按行計費,我覺得要考慮下用換行。
Python 表示沒有這種煩惱。
5、縮進(jìn)使用 tab 鍵還是空格
tab vs 4 spaces
Github 上對400000的統(tǒng)計,空格還是居多:
如果格式統(tǒng)一都還好,碰到過 tab 鍵和空格混用的項目,簡直崩潰。
6、電腦買 Windows 的還是 Mac
開發(fā)人員應(yīng)該使用 Linux 系統(tǒng),有銀子用 mac OS,不要用 Windows。
7、版本控制
用 SVN 還是 Git?
算了我還是直接 FTP 修改吧。
8、Web 服務(wù)器
論壇上有人測試出 Nginx 性能不如 Apache、IIS,然后就炸了。
前端表示我們只需要 Node.js。
9、開發(fā)做前端好還是后端好
后端工資高、前端沒什么技術(shù)含量。
10、程序員工資都很高
免責(zé)聲明:本文素材來源網(wǎng)絡(luò),版權(quán)歸原作者所有。如涉及作品版權(quán)問題,請與我聯(lián)系刪除。
C語言常用轉(zhuǎn)換函數(shù)實現(xiàn)原理
STM32Cube生態(tài)系統(tǒng)更新的那些實用功能
GitHub在Git 2.28中推進(jìn)master/slave名稱更換
長按前往圖中包含的公眾號關(guān)注
免責(zé)聲明:本文內(nèi)容由21ic獲得授權(quán)后發(fā)布,版權(quán)歸原作者所有,本平臺僅提供信息存儲服務(wù)。文章僅代表作者個人觀點,不代表本平臺立場,如有問題,請聯(lián)系我們,謝謝!